NIPR Citizens’ Summit will Provide Solutions to Nigeria’s Lost Hopes–Mukhtar Sirajo

The ‘Citizens Summit for National Integration, Peace and Security’, which will soon be convened nationwide by the Nigerian Institute of Public Relations, NIPR, is not an avenue to find faults among Nigerians, the political class or ethnic groups.

But to find solutions for Nigeria’s lost hopes.

This is according to the President and Chairman of NIPR’s Governing Board, Mallam Mukhtar Sirajo, who disclosed this in Abuja on Tuesday.

He stated this when he received the leadership of the ‘Association of Inter-ethnic Married Nigerians’, who paid him a courtesy visit at the NIPR National Secretariat.

Sirajo, who said their Organizing Committee has gone far in planning how to host the Summit across the federation, explained that the response of teeming Nigerians to their forthcoming NIPR’s event is one that is given them tremendous encouragement.

“Many Nigerians we marketed the Citizens’ Summit idea believe it is a timely and worthy one. One that will make Nigeria a lot better than it is now. It is a Summit that will enable Nigeria to retrace its steps,” said the NIPR helmsman.

He emphasized the need to showcase to world the products of inter-ethnic and inter-religious marriages in Nigeria, in order to project one of the positive aspects of the country’s national existence.

Comrade Jacob Obi, Founder and President of the Association, in his remark at the event, said their visit was informed by the need to partner NIPR to actualize the cardinal objectives of their body.

He said: “It is about time Nigerians allow their children to marry whomsoever their hearts desire, in order to unite the country.”
